上一页 1 ··· 3 4 5 6 7 8 9 10 11 ··· 23 下一页

2021年9月26日

go实现http的请求方式&接受参数方式

摘要: 1.默认的常规方法 //默认多路复用器 import ( "fmt" "net/http" ) func IndexHand (w http.ResponseWriter,r *http.Request) { content:="this is test info" fmt.Fprint(w,con 阅读全文

posted @ 2021-09-26 16:16 孤灯引路人 阅读(1715) 评论(0) 推荐(0) 编辑

2021年9月23日

go使用mime/multipart包案例

摘要: 1.multipart实现了MIME的multipart解析,参见RFC 2046。该实现适用于HTTP(RFC 2388)和常见浏览器生成的multipart主体,个人理解期本质就是默认from在网络中传输格式 案例一:普通普通表单上传后端程序 func main() { buf:=new(byt 阅读全文

posted @ 2021-09-23 15:00 孤灯引路人 阅读(735) 评论(0) 推荐(0) 编辑

go发送请求get|post

摘要: golang要请求远程网页,可以使用net/http包中的client提供的方法实现。查看了官方网站有一些示例,没有太全面的例子,于是自己整理了一下 get请求 get请求可以直接http.Get方法,非常简单 func httpGet() { resp, err := http.Get("http 阅读全文

posted @ 2021-09-23 13:34 孤灯引路人 阅读(392) 评论(0) 推荐(0) 编辑

2021年8月26日

go 实现爬虫

摘要: 一:使用go获取远程图片存储在本地案例 1>生成随机数 len:=32 bytes:=make([]byte,len) r:=rand.New(rand.NewSource(time.Now().Unix())) for i:=0;i<len;i++ { b:=r.Intn(26)+65 bytes 阅读全文

posted @ 2021-08-26 14:33 孤灯引路人 阅读(845) 评论(0) 推荐(0) 编辑

2021年8月23日

go,redis实现订阅和发布

摘要: 1.服务端代码 【备注:这是服务端没秒发送一个数据导发布频道里面】 package main import ( "fmt" "github.com/go-redis/redis" "math/rand" "time" ) func main(){ redisConnect() } func redi 阅读全文

posted @ 2021-08-23 16:29 孤灯引路人 阅读(567) 评论(0) 推荐(0) 编辑

2021年7月26日

使用队列问题

摘要: 消息队列优势 消息队列(Message Queue,简称MQ),其主要用于在复杂的微服务系统中进行消息通信,它的优点可以大致整理成以下几点: 服务间解耦 提高服务并发、性能 突发流量削峰 ... 服务间解耦 微服务系统业务之间相互依赖,各种调用错综复杂,如果不能良好对服务进行解耦那一个服务的可用性、 阅读全文

posted @ 2021-07-26 13:50 孤灯引路人 阅读(55) 评论(0) 推荐(0) 编辑

tp5.1使用队列

摘要: 1.基础条件 thinkphp5.1 think-queue2.04 2.安装think-queue composer require topthink/think-queue 3.写配置文件 一:项目所在目录/www/edu/infoaa/config下面的queue.php文件写入配置 retu 阅读全文

posted @ 2021-07-26 13:30 孤灯引路人 阅读(403) 评论(0) 推荐(0) 编辑

2021年7月16日

go文件&&目录操作

摘要: 一:常规文件 1.go读取文件第一种做法【案例就是复制文件】 filePath:="./show.txt" copyFilepath:="./copy.txt" file,_:=os.Open(filePath) defer file.Close() buf:=make([]byte,1024) f 阅读全文

posted @ 2021-07-16 13:20 孤灯引路人 阅读(247) 评论(0) 推荐(0) 编辑

2021年6月22日

gocurd案例

摘要: 1.使用go的mysql扩展实现curd 1.前提条件根据表的结构创建一个结构体 type Student struct { Id int Uid int Suject string Scores int cate_id int } 1.查询单条数据 //查询单条数据 func SelectOne( 阅读全文

posted @ 2021-06-22 16:49 孤灯引路人 阅读(126) 评论(0) 推荐(0) 编辑

2021年5月8日

Go module的介绍及使用

摘要: 1.Modules是Go 1.11中新增的实验性功能,是一种新型的包管理工具。使用前确保go version在1.11以上 1.查看环境变量 E:\go\src\test>go env 2.设置go Modules运行 E:\go\src\test>go env -w GO111MODULE=on 阅读全文

posted @ 2021-05-08 17:03 孤灯引路人 阅读(625) 评论(0) 推荐(0) 编辑

上一页 1 ··· 3 4 5 6 7 8 9 10 11 ··· 23 下一页

导航